College selection is a complex interaction of
numerous factors. This book investigated the
reasons that student-athletes select the United
States Military Academy as their college choice.
Data were collected from freshman students and
analyzed using a repeated measures multiple analysis
of variance (MANOVA) on twenty-three college
selection variables. Post hoc pairwise comparisons
were used to determine the importance of these
selection factors. The results indicated the
important factors for the different groups of
student-athletes in the selection process. For all
groups, excellent teachers were the most important
factor in their college selection. Coaches should
emphasize the quality of teachers, the opportunity
to play at the Division I level, the academics, the
athletic tradition/reputation, the opportunity to
win championships and the campus/campus visit when
recruiting prospective student-athletes. Coaches
should also build positive relationships with the
parents and the student-athletes in the recruiting
process. Coaches can use this information to become
more effective and efficient in the recruitment of
student-athletes.
